Lone Wolf and Cub

Lone Wolf and Cub

The Roaring Thunder (3x18)


Air date: Aug 01, 1976

  • Premiered: Apr 1973
  • Episodes: 78
  • Followers: 4
  • Ended
  • Omni
  • Unknown